Veri tabanı sorgularinda performansı artırmak için en iyi yöntemler nelerdir?
Veri Tabanı Sorgularında Performansı Artırmak için En İyi Yöntemler
Veri tabanı sorgu performansını artırmak için aşağıdaki yöntemleri uygulayabilirsiniz:
- İndeksleme: Sıklıkla sorgulanan alanlar için indeks oluşturmak, sorgu sürelerini önemli ölçüde azaltır.
- Query Optimizasyonu: Sorguların yapısını gözden geçirerek gereksiz JOIN'leri ve alt sorguları azaltmak, performansı artırır.
- Veri Normalizasyonu: Veritabanını uygun şekilde normalleştirerek tekrarlayan verileri azaltmak, veri tutarlılığını sağlar.
- Ön Bellekleme: Sık erişilen verileri ön belleğe almak, bu verilere erişimi hızlandırır.
- Partitioning: Büyük veri setlerini daha yönetilebilir parçalara ayırmak, sorguları hızlandırabilir.
- Veri Türlerinin Doğru Seçimi: Alanlar için en uygun veri türlerini seçmek, depolama ve performans açısından faydalıdır.
Bu yöntemlerin uygulanması, sorgu performansını optimize eder ve sistem kaynaklarını daha verimli kullanmanıza yardımcı olur.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Veri tabanı nasıl tasarlanır ve veri modelleme süreci nasıl ilerler?
- İpucu ve teknikler için en iyi kaynaklar nelerdir?
- Otomatik park sistemlerinde kullanılan sensörler hangi teknolojiyi kullanır?
- Python dilinde bir değişken nasıl tanımlanır ve kullanılır?
- Güvenlik duvarı nedir ve internet kullanıcıları için neden önemlidir?
- Python’da bir listeyi tersine çevirmenin en basit yolu nedir?
- Veri yapıları ve algoritmaların iş dünyasında ne gibi faydaları vardır?
- Python'da bir stringi tersten yazdırmak için hangi yöntemleri kullanabilirim?
- CAP teoremi ve PACELC açıklaması: pratik etkileri nelerdir?
- Yazılım mühendisliği öğrencileri için en etkili problem çözme stratejileri nelerdir?
- Veri analizinde en sık kullanılan istatistiksel dağılım türleri hangileridir?
- Arrow functions kullanırken nelere dikkat etmeliyim?
- Python’da bir liste içerisindeki en büyük ve en küçük sayıları nasıl bulurum?
- Robotik mühendislik alanında en yaygın kullanılan programlama dili hangisidir?
- En iyi yerel veritabanı seçenekleri nelerdir?
- PaaS nedir?
- Python’da bir string ifadenin uzunluğunu nasıl bulabilirim?
- En iyi ücretsiz antivirüs programları hangileri?
- Yapay zeka mühendisliği okumak ne kadar zor?
- Mühendislik Alanında İş Deneyimi Kazanmanın En Etkili Yolu Nedir?